Most of this book is as relevant today as it was in 1936. Dale Carnegie recommends it in his book "How to win friends and influence people" (which was also a bestseller around the same time). Don't be put off by the word 'religion' in the title since this is not a book about religion as such - rather the religious connection is that many commonsense/practical/psychologically sound ideas about effective living can be drawn from religion. Henry Link was the 'Dr Phil' of his day. He was actually against too much personal reflection and inward searching, and saw the path to psychological health and well-being as involving getting out into society, learning new skills, interacting with other people, looking outside oneself.

Immensely popular in his time he wrote other books expanding on his ideas - for example "The way to security", "The rediscovery of man".
